This refers to software designed to improve the sound quality of audio output on devices utilizing the Android operating system. It enhances the listening experience by implementing algorithms that process the audio signal to boost clarity, bass response, and overall sound fidelity. For example, a user might install an application of this type on their smartphone to enjoy richer and more immersive music playback.
Such enhancements are valuable because they address limitations inherent in the audio hardware of many mobile devices. The integrated speakers and amplifiers often lack the power and sophistication to reproduce sound with optimal clarity and depth. Using this type of software can effectively compensate for these hardware deficiencies, leading to a more enjoyable and engaging audio experience. Historically, these technologies evolved from desktop audio processing applications and have been adapted for the mobile environment.
